The 2024 USC Trojans baseball team represents the University of Southern California during the 2024 NCAA Division I baseball season . Due to Dedeaux Field being renovated the Trojans will be playing their home games at OC Great Park Baseball Complex , Anteater Ballpark in Irvine , and Page Stadium in Los Angeles .[2] The team is coached by Andy Stankiewicz in his 2nd season at USC.
Previous season [ edit ]
The Trojans ended the 2023 season with a record of 17-13 in conference play and 34-23-1 overall record good for 4th place in the Pac-12. They would play in the Pac-12 tournament as the #4 Seed on Pool C in Game 1 of Pool Play they would beat rival UCLA by a score of 6-4, then in Game 2 of Pool Play they would lose to Washington eliminating them from the tournament and ending their season.
